Representation Summary:

The North East Cambridge development is, as you state, 'predicated on the relocation of the existing Waste Water Treatment Works, a process being led by Anglian Water'. The relocation is totally unnecessary according to Anglian Water therefore the current Waste Water Treatment Works (WWTW) site is not a Brown Field Site. The proposed WWTW relocation to Honey Hill in the Green Belt itself is at odds with the Councils own policies. The cost of £227million is a scandalous amount of taxpayers money to produce a bogus brown field site.
